U+75AC "疬" CJK Unified Ideograph-# is a Chinese character used in traditional and simplified writing, classified under the radical for illness (疒) and typically associated with diseases or medical conditions. It primarily denotes scrofula, a form of tuberculosis affecting the lymph nodes, and is often found in historical or classical medical texts rather than modern everyday language. In Chinese, it is pronounced as "lì" in Mandarin, and its use is limited, generally appearing in compound terms related to lymphatic swellings or similar ailments.
